Announcements on radio stations as far away as Manhattan were giving updates of the traffic jams on television, and the news stations discouraged people from setting off to the festival. After much pushback, promoters were in a tight spot but eventually found a farm owner named Max Yasgur who accepted $10,000 cash up front to let them have a small festival on his 300-acre property.
